◊ The Packaging Machinery Market at a Glance
The packaging automation industry is experiencing robust growth, driven by demands for higher efficiency, product safety, and supply chain resilience. Globally, the packaging automation market is a multi-billion-dollar sector with a promising future.
-
Significant Growth Trajectory: The global market for packaging automation is projected to grow at a steady compound annual growth rate (CAGR) through 2031. Specifically, the production line end-of-line packaging equipment sector alone was valued at approximately $7.16 billion in 2024 and is expected to reach nearly $12.32 billion by 2031, reflecting a strong CAGR of 8.7%. This indicates widespread investment in automating the final stages of production.
-
A Concentated Competitive Landscape: The market features a mix of long-established international giants and innovative regional specialists. Competition is strong, with the top five manufacturers holding a significant share of the global market. Key players driving innovation include names like Rockwell Automation, ABB, and Siemens, who are central to the industry’s technological evolution.

◊ Key Global Packaging Machinery Manufacturers
Navigating the vast field of suppliers can be daunting. The following table highlights some of the leading packaging machinery manufacturers renowned for their innovation, reliability, and global reach.
| Manufacturer | Core Specialization | Notable Strength |
|---|---|---|
| Tetra Pak International S.A. | Food & Beverage Aseptic Packaging | Pioneering sustainable, recyclable materials and intelligent packaging solutions for liquid foods. |
| Krones AG | Beverage and Liquid Food Packaging | Expertise in integrated filling, inspection, and labeling technologies for high-speed production lines. |
| Syntegon Technology GmbH | Processing and Packaging Machinery | Strong focus on product integrity, regulatory compliance, and intelligent digital solutions. |
| GEA Group | Packaging for Dairy, Beverage & Food | Smart integration of digital technologies and predictive maintenance for high hygiene standards. |
| ProMach, Inc. | Diverse Packaging Technologies & Automation | Broad portfolio of modular technologies for labeling, filling, and inspection across industries. |
| IMA Group | Pharmaceutical & Food Packaging | Leadership in automatic counting and weighing lines, including vertical and horizontal flow wrapping. |
| Barry-Wehmiller Companies, Inc. | Comprehensive Packaging Automation | Strong focus on building partnerships and providing customized service and lifecycle support. |
Deep Dive into Manufacturer Specializations:
-
Food and Beverage Focus: Companies like Tetra Pak and Krones lead in segments like aseptic carton packaging and beverage bottling, focusing on extending shelf life and maximizing production line efficiency.
-
Pharmaceutical Precision: For the medical and pharmaceutical sectors, manufacturers like IMA Group and Syntegon provide equipment that meets stringent regulatory standards, ensures sterility, and offers tamper-evident solutions.
-
E-commerce and Adaptability: The rise of online retail has spurred demand for versatile packaging machinery suppliers. Companies like Pregis and Sealed Air offer automated solutions that can quickly switch between packaging different product types and sizes, which is crucial for fulfillment centers handling diverse SKUs.
◊ Dominant Market Trends Shaping the Industry
A forward-thinking packaging machinery manufacturer doesn’t just sell equipment; it provides solutions aligned with the macro-trends transforming the industry.
-
The Automation and Industry 4.0 Revolution: The integration of smart technologies is no longer optional. Modern packaging lines are increasingly equipped with IoT sensors and cloud connectivity, enabling real-time monitoring, predictive maintenance, and data-driven optimization of machine performance. This shift towards “smart factories” is a central theme for all major suppliers.
-
Sustainability as a Core Driver: Under growing regulatory pressure and consumer demand for eco-friendly products, sustainability has become a key purchasing factor. Leading manufacturers are responding by developing machinery compatible with recyclable, compostable, and lightweight materials. The focus is on creating a circular economy for packaging, from source to disposal.
-
Demand for Flexibility and Customization: The era of rigid, single-purpose packaging lines is fading. Manufacturers now seek equipment that can handle a wide variety of products, package sizes, and materials with minimal changeover time. This has led to a rise in modular machine designs and adaptable solutions from packaging machinery suppliers.
-
Growth in Key Regional Markets: While North America and Europe remain mature and significant markets, the Asia-Pacific region, particularly China, is expected to be the fastest-growing market for packaging machinery. This growth is fueled by rapid industrialization, expanding food and beverage sectors, and the boom in e-commerce.

◊ How to Choose the Right Packaging Machinery Manufacturer
Selecting the right partner requires a strategic assessment of your unique needs. Here is a framework to guide your decision:
-
Define Your Application and Products: Clearly identify the types of products you need to package (e.g., liquid, solid, fragile), your required output speeds, and the packaging materials you plan to use. This will immediately narrow down the list of suitable packaging machinery manufacturers with relevant expertise.
-
Evaluate Technology and Integration Capabilities: Assess the manufacturer’s technological prowess. Do they offer user-friendly PLC controls? Is their equipment compatible with IoT and data analytics platforms? Consider how easily the new machinery will integrate with your existing production line.
-
Analyze Total Cost of Ownership (TCO): Look beyond the initial purchase price. Consider long-term costs, including energy consumption, maintenance requirements, availability of spare parts, and the total cost of consumables. A reliable, durable machine from a reputable packaging machinery supplier often offers better value than a cheaper, less robust alternative.
-
Verify After-Sales Support and Service: The relationship doesn’t end at installation. Ensure the manufacturer has a strong network for technical support, maintenance, and operator training. Prompt and reliable service is critical for minimizing production downtime.
